The Kano Electricity Distribution Company (KEDCO) reported power outages in parts of Kano, Katsina and Kaduna states after a strong windstorm knocked down 13 electricity poles.

In a statement released on Wednesday, KEDCO said the storm caused the collapse of 13 poles along feeder lines that supply electricity to several communities.

The outages affected Dandume in Katsina State; Rogo, Sundu, Falgore, Tudun Wada, Saya Saya, Kadawa and Hago in Kano State; and Ikara in Kaduna State.

"The windstorm damaged 13 electricity poles along affected feeder lines, resulting in power interruption in the affected areas," the company added.

KEDCO apologized to residents for the disruption and confirmed that repair work is underway to restore power as quickly as possible.
